July 28 2011 a Friendly versus Norwich City ended 0-0.
 
March 31 2003 Steve Tilson testimonial v England XI. Southend won 8-2.
Southend scorers:- Tes Bramble3, Steven Clark, Brett Darby2 and Mark Rawle2.
England XI scorers:- Steve Tilson and Clive Allen

The crowd was 4,555 and Michael Kightly came on as a sub for Bramble. Kevin Maher also played for Southend, and alongside Tilson, Chris Powell also represented the England XI.
 
As already mentioned, the Wimbledon game was in the Football League Group Cup. Derek Spence scored for us and Paul Lazarus got both goals for Wimbledon in front of a crowd of 1,780.
 
The last one I can help you with (I only started going in August 1967 so the other 2 games pre-date me) :-

Monday January 19th 1970 Essex Professional Cup 1st round replay finished Southend Utd 2 Chelmsford City 3. Goal scorers were Bill Garner and Gary Moore for Southend and Andrews, Price and Amato for Chelmsford. It went to extra time, was 2-1 to Chelmsford at h-t, and the crowd was 2,297.

He had actually been dropped for the previous game a couple of days earlier. Anyway that stunning volley (which I saw but have no recollection of) ensured that he played every game until the season end, playing his part to the full in our first ever relegation !
 
I’ve checked out all the answers given-just one minor error-Chris Barnard didn’t score v Clacton,Bobby King got 2.
And the Essex Professional Cup Final,all games in that competition were full first team fixtures,was won 4-2(1-1 at ht).Our scorers were Woodley,Slack,Smillie 2.Brennan and Smith replied for Chelmsford who had Costello at right-back.

The Essex Professional Cup Final of 1966-67 was played over 2 legs. The 1st leg was played at Chelmsford City on Monday 22nd.May with Chelmsford winning by 1-0.(Att.2,891).
In the 2nd leg at Roots Hall on Friday 26th.May Southend United won by 4-2 with the Southend goals being scored by Andy Smillie(2);Derek Woodley & Mel Slack.(Att.3,025). Southend United win 4-3 on aggregate.
The above information was obtained from the Southend United Football Supporters' Club Official Handbook 1967-68.
